		<description><![CDATA[Good news for all YouTube users who’s ever thought about the limit of video length that is just too short. Now YouTube announced that they have increase the limit of video length from 10 minutes to 15 minutes. In 2006, YouTube added a 10 minute video time restriction because a large number of users uploaded full-length TV shows and movies. &#8230;]]></description>

		<description><![CDATA[The YouTube API blog has just introduced a new embedding style for HTML5 . The new code uses HTML iframe tag. Users will be able to see the video in either HTML5 or Flash players, based on their web browsers and preferences.  Browsers that allow to use HTML5 videoplayer are listed on YouTube HTML5 settings page. 		<description><![CDATA[ISLAMABAD: Govt Of Pakistan has blocked the most popular video sharing website &#8220;YouTube&#8220;  because of blasphemous and un-islamic content. As Facebook was banned due to an event encourage users to post the images of the Prophet Muhammad (peace be upon him).
